Why Test data management is a pain in insurance application testing?
The insurance sector is facing challenges in the form of growing system complexities, competition, the advent of new skills and tool sets, and emerging security threats. The industry is shifting focus from its previously held ‘business as usual’ model to transforming its legacy applications and systems. The transformation includes refining the business processes to improving the customer experiences and streamlining the distribution channels. Like other sectors, insurance too is embracing the development of software applications in a big way. While doing so, the sector is adopting Agile development methodologies and cloud-based solutions.
However, notwithstanding the above-mentioned challenges, the insurance sector is finding itself hamstrung when it concerns test data management. This is because data remains sensitive and interdependent, not to speak of displaying high redundancy. Also, since insurance companies are aiming to drive user adoption of applications, they need to implement rigorous insurance application testing. The comprehensive testing shall cover segments such as life and casualty, health, and property.
Why test data management is a challenge?
The sensitive nature of data maintained by the insurance industry needs to be protected from emerging cyber security threats. However, maintaining the integrity of such data can encompass a host of challenges for the insurance industry.
# Growing complexity of services: The insurance industry is highly diverse with a slew of products catering to segments like life, health, and property. Each of the products cutting across segments and transactions like claims, policy renewal, and contract management, etc. have their unique workflows. Any insurance app containing scores of data and catering to these complex business scenarios would need to be validated through insurance app testing. To ensure the workflows operate optimally and meet their desired objectives, they should be tested against expected outcomes. These combine to make test data management a tedious and risk-prone exercise.
# Need to maintain continuous delivery: In the Agile and DevOps driven Software Development Life Cycle, insurance applications need to be developed, tested, and delivered on time, and within budget. Furthermore, since applications deliver value to the end customers 24x7, they need to be kept updated at all times. So, while testing applications, should there be any provisioning of poor-quality data, the same can lead to erroneous results.
# Compliance with regulations: The insurance sector is governed by several regulations, which are updated from time to time. This entails the applications to incorporate such regulatory changes as and when they come into force in the form of new releases. These releases need to be validated through insurance software testing making data management an arduous exercise. Also, the data given for insurance app testing should be adequately masked to prevent any leak. For should the regulations are not adhered to by the applications, there can be adverse consequences like data breach, regulatory censure, penalties, the lowering of brand visibility, and revenue loss.
# Security breaches: The menace of cyber crime is growing by the day and the insurance sector is not immune to it. The applications should be robust enough to meet the threats and safeguard data. Since the insurance sector is getting competitive and customers increasingly cognizant of the security aspect, the applications should be validated for security. Thus, the testing for insurance applications is imperative to generate confidence among stakeholders and prevent threats of data breaches.
# Faster product release: The competitive nature of the insurance industry entails the release of numerous products in a short time frame. Since each product deals with a large quantum of data, ensuring their integrity becomes a big issue. The quick release of insurance products presents very little window for developers as well as testers to validate the codes, ensure their integration, and remove glitches. The hurried approach does not leave much time for testers to set up crucial test infrastructure and identify data.
# Application complexity: The varied nature of insurance products and their objectives are often lost on the developers. The lack of knowledge among developers about the scope of such products and their objectives can work as a detriment to set up the much-needed environment to test data.
# Need to employ automation and standardization: The diverse nature of the insurance industry makes it difficult to employ technologies such as automation and data mining. Furthermore, the data is often unstructured and non-standardized leaving little leeway for the testers to execute comprehensive testing.
Conclusion
The fast-growing insurance industry requires customer-friendly instruments like mobile or web applications to bring in convenience, user-friendliness, security, and better outcomes. To ensure the same, a robust test data management exercise should be undertaken by employing cutting-edge technologies.

3 Ways Automated Claim Admin System is driving user convenience for Insurance providers
The insurance market is growing at a phenomenal rate with new players entering the market and niche players of yore finding it difficult to live up to growing customer expectations. One of the areas where insurance companies need to tighten their delivery systems is claim processing. In fact, it can redraw the relationship that insurers have with their customers. An automated claim admin system can be the ultimate differentiator for any insurer in expanding its market share and achieving profitability. No wonder insurance companies, old as well as new, are looking to improve their customer experience by speeding up claim processing. So, when an effective automated claim admin system can tilt the scales for any insurer as far as retaining the market is concerned, how can insurance application testing stay behind?
Insurance companies from across the world are faced with the twin challenges of customer acquisition and retention. And to address the same, an effective claim processing system has become the need of the hour. This is a significant departure from the existing claim processing systems carrying lengthy and error-prone manual procedures. The legacy systems with large manual interfaces have issues like data inconsistency, lack of transparency, poor performance, and fraudulent claims. These issues have a negative impact on deliverables such as timeliness, accuracy, and customer experience. Moreover, such claim processing systems running on legacy platforms with interfaces across geographies and digital touchpoints have made accuracy and detection of frauds a difficult exercise.
To deal with such challenges, insurers need an automated claim processing system that is comprehensive in its scope and collaborative in its execution. This brings into the equation the need to conduct a rigorous insurance app testing exercise to ensure quality in its performance. However, let us first understand the consequences of persisting with the present system of claim processing.
Challenges of not having an automated claim processing system
Less transparency as most stakeholders do not have any say (or insight) into the whole process or system.
High turnaround time for processing claims, leading to customer dissatisfaction.
The manual way of tracking and managing data (stored in physical storage like ledgers) leads to errors. The errors can get compounded when it comes to missing out on tracking fraudulent claims.
Siloed processes with minimal or no collaboration with each other leading to delays.
Poor integration of processes leading to a less than ideal decision-making process. This is due to the fact that the entire decision-making process is not centralized but is rather disparate and incoherent.
Ineffective communication across channels causing delays.
Poor verification of critical personal and business data can lead to an increase in fraudulent claims.
Delay in claims processing leading to reduced customer loyalty.
Insurance company faltering when it comes to customer acquisition and retention.
The end-to-end automated claim processing system would help insurers to proactively monitor and administer the lifecycle of an insurance claim, comprising phases such as settlement and closure. Often the delay is caused when external stakeholders such as third-party administrators do not deliver their inputs in time. However, with the automated system duly validated by the insurance testing services, every stakeholder, internal or external is integrated into the workflow. This leads the insurer to exercise tighter control throughout the process.
An automated claim admin system driving better user experience
An automated claims processing system comprising myriad service components can help any insurer in augmenting capabilities, speeding up closures, streamlining workflows, identifying fraudulent cases, reducing costs, and enhancing operational efficiencies. Let us illustrate the same for better understanding.
Achieving seamless interactions by sourcing and classifying inbound data – from internal systems and third parties.
Reducing administrative tasks and time spent in executing them. This helps to generate a better customer experience.
Ensuring the protection of sensitive personal and business data.
Promoting faster processing of claims – aided by insurance software testing.
Reducing the likelihood of errors by replacing manual inputs.
Offering quick and seamless access to products and services for customers.
Facilitating quick decision making when it comes to critical situations like the identification of fraudulent claims.
Meeting the expectations of policyholders with quick and accurate processing of claims.
Enabling greater cost efficiency by reducing the processing steps.
Three ways an automated claim admin system can drive UX
Speedy claim resolution: A major pique that customers have with the insurance providers is about the inordinate delay that takes in the processing of claims. However, the centralized software system with the minimal human interface can cut barriers and fasten processing.
24/7 service: Customers need not require to visit the offices of insurance companies at inconvenient hours. They can apply for claims at their chosen time and location.
Increased accuracy: It has been observed that insurance companies more often than not reduce the quantum of claims’ amount. This is due to the arbitrariness often exercised by officials at various stages of processing. An automated system can get rid of such anomalies.
Conclusion
The customers of today are not satisfied with mediocre services. This makes insurance companies with legacy systems to either reform/transform or perish. Developing an automated claim processing system and integrating the same in the workflow can help in breaking internal barriers and enhancing the customer experience. The latter can be leveraged by insurers in shoring up their balance sheets and staying a step ahead of their competitors. Since the stakes are significantly higher for insurers, the automated claims processing system should be subjected to insurance domain testing. This can ensure the system remains robust, scalable, dynamic, and secure. Importantly, it should facilitate the tracking of fraudulent claims and save the company lots in revenue.
